Demographics — Roosevelt

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Roosevelt has a population of 1,060, which has increased by 32.0% over the past 5 years. Roosevelt is a popular place for families, as children make up 31.1% of the population. The area has a highly educated workforce, with 45.7%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are some residents working remotely, with 19.7% reporting working from home.

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Roosevelt is a predominantly white area, with 61.3% of the population identifying as white. The white population has shrunk by 29.7%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in Roosevelt is hispanic, making up 34.4%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 10.9% of the population in Roosevelt, and this percentage has increased by 45.3%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ting more immigrants are calling the area home.
